[0001] The present application relates to the field of radiotherapy equipment, and in particular to an ionization chamber installation device for a medical linear accelerator. Background Art
[0002] A medical linear accelerator (LINAC) is a device that uses radiation to treat tumors. The ionization chamber is typically located within the treatment head of a LINAC, between the primary collimator and the aperture. Its primary function is to monitor the radiation dose and ensure that the radiation reaches the tumor area at the desired dose.
[0003] The ionization chamber operates by providing feedback on radiation intensity through the current generated by the ionizing effect of radiation on the internal medium. Consequently, the ionization chamber is exposed to radiation for extended periods, resulting in a limited operating lifespan and requiring frequent repair or replacement. Furthermore, since the ionization chamber is located within the treatment head, repairs require disassembly of the entire treatment head, increasing both time and cost. Utility Model Content
[0004] In view of this, the present invention provides an ionization chamber installation device, which allows the ionization chamber to be pulled out from the treatment head for easy maintenance and replacement. It also has a positioning function, so that the position of the ionization chamber remains basically unchanged after each installation, reducing or eliminating the need for correction of the position of the ionization chamber.

Figures 1 to 3 As shown, the ionization chamber installation device in the present application includes: an ionization chamber push-pull slide 11, an ionization chamber mounting plate 12, a mounting plate pressing block 13, an ionization chamber positioning member 14 and a positioning pin 15;
[0035] Slide rails 101 are provided on both sides of the top of the ionization chamber push-pull slide 11;
[0036] The ionization chamber mounting plate 12 is slidably mounted on the slide rail 101 of the ionization chamber push-pull slide 11; the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 is provided with a mounting hole 21 for mounting the ionization chamber 10; a bayonet 22 is provided at the rear end of the ionization chamber mounting plate 12;
[0037] The ionization chamber positioning members 14 are arranged on both sides of the top of the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 and respectively abut against the two side edges of the ionization chamber 10;
[0038] The mounting plate pressing block 13 is provided at the front end of the ionization chamber push-pull slide 11 and is used to abut against the front end of the ionization chamber mounting plate 12;
[0039] The positioning pin 15 is provided at the top rear end of the ionization chamber push-pull slide 11 and is used to abut against the bayonet 22 of the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 .
[0040] When using the above-mentioned ionization chamber mounting device of the present application, the bottom of the ionization chamber push-pull slide 11 can be first fixed to the treatment head (not shown in the figure), and then the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 can be slid and set on the slide rail 101 of the ionization chamber push-pull slide 11, so that the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 can slide freely on the slide rail 101; then, the ionization chamber 10 can be installed on the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 through the mounting screws 23 and the mounting holes 21 on the ionization chamber mounting plate 12. When the ionization chamber 10 is first installed, the ionization chamber 10 can be first installed and fixed on the ionization chamber mounting plate 12, and then the corresponding ionization chamber positioning members 14 can be respectively set and fixed on both sides of the top of the ionization chamber mounting plate 12, so that the ionization chamber positioning members 14 are closely attached to the two side edges of the ionization chamber 10. After installing the ionization chamber positioning member 14, each time the ionization chamber 10 is disassembled, if the ionization chamber 10 needs to be reinstalled, the two side edges of the ionization chamber 10 can be placed tightly against the ionization chamber positioning member 14 before the ionization chamber 10 is fixed and installed, thereby ensuring the consistency of the position of the ionization chamber 10 after each installation. In addition, the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 can be pushed and slid on the slide rail 101 until the retaining hole 22 at the rear end of the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 abuts against the positioning pin 15 (the positioning pin 15 can provide a positioning function for the ionization chamber mounting plate 12); then, the mounting plate pressing block 13 can be installed and fixed to the front end of the ionization chamber push-pull slide 11, abutting against the front end of the ionization chamber mounting plate 12, pressing the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 tightly, ensuring that the retaining hole 22 of the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 is tightly against the positioning pin 15, and completing the positioning between the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 and the ionization chamber push-pull slide 11.
[0041] In addition, as an example, Figure 1As shown, in a specific embodiment of the present application, the ionization chamber positioning member 14 may include: a positioning block 141 and a positioning block mounting screw 142;
[0042] The positioning block 141 is fixed to the top of the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 by the positioning block mounting screws 142 .
[0043] In addition, as an example, Figure 1 and Figure 3 As shown, in a specific embodiment of the present application, the mounting plate pressing block 13 can be installed and fixed to the front end of the ionization chamber push-pull slide 11 by a screw 31 that does not come out.
[0044] The above-mentioned non-slip screw 31 can prevent the non-slip screw 31 from falling from the mounting plate pressing block 13 when the mounting plate pressing block 13 is removed, thereby greatly reducing the risk of the screw falling into the interior of the treatment head during removal.
[0045] In addition, as an example, Figure 3 As shown, in a specific embodiment of the present application, a first inclined surface is provided at one end of the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 that contacts the mounting plate pressing block 13, and a second inclined surface is provided at one side of the mounting plate pressing block 13 that contacts the ionization chamber mounting plate 12; the inclination angles of the first inclined surface and the second inclined surface are different.
[0046] Therefore, when the non-slipping screw 31 is gradually tightened, the second inclined surface of the mounting plate pressing block 13 will push the first inclined surface of the ionization chamber mounting plate 12, so that the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 moves toward its rear end and toward the top of the ionization chamber push-pull slide 11; when the non-slipping screw 31 is locked, the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 will be positioned in the height direction and the front-back direction.
[0047] In addition, as an example, Figure 1 and Figure 3 As shown, in a specific embodiment of the present application, the ionization chamber installation device may further include: a handle 16;
[0048] The handle 16 is disposed at the front end of the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 .
[0049] By providing the handle 16 , the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 can be easily pushed and pulled, so that the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 slides on the slide rail 101 of the ionization chamber push-pull slide 11 .
[0050] In addition, as an example, Figure 3 As shown, in a specific embodiment of the present application, the handle 16 can be fixed to the front end of the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 by a handle mounting screw 61 .
[0051] In addition, as an example, Figure 4 As shown, in a specific embodiment of the present application, a third inclined surface 41 is provided on the side where the bayonet 22 on the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 contacts the positioning pin 15, and a fourth inclined surface 42 is provided on the side where the positioning pin 15 contacts the bayonet 22; the inclination angles of the third inclined surface 41 and the fourth inclined surface 42 are different.
[0052] In addition, as an example, Figure 5 As shown, in a specific embodiment of the present application, the wide width of the opening of the bayonet 22 is greater than the width of the bottom of the bayonet 22 .
[0053] Therefore, as the screw 31 is gradually tightened without dislodging, the positioning pin 15 first contacts the wide section at the opening of the retaining hole 22 of the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 and gradually slides to the narrow section at the bottom of the retaining hole 22. The narrow section and the positioning pin 15 have a high degree of fit precision, enabling precise positioning. Furthermore, because the third and fourth inclined surfaces have different inclination angles, they are ensured to be in close contact when the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 is positioned. This close contact between the two inclined surfaces generates an upward force on the ionization chamber mounting plate 12, thereby exerting an upward force on each of the front and rear sides of the ionization chamber mounting plate 12, thereby achieving vertical positioning of the ionization chamber mounting plate 12.
[0054] In addition, as an example, in a specific embodiment of the present application, the rear end of the ionization chamber mounting plate 12 is provided with two bayonet holes 22; the top rear end of the ionization chamber push-pull slide 11 is provided with two positioning pins 15 corresponding to the two bayonet holes 22 respectively.
